

Phyllis passed away on Friday, July 31, 2026, at the age of 97 in Wichita, Kansas. She was born to Albert and Phyllis (McCarthy) Clark on June 1, 1929, in York, Nebraska. She was the second oldest of nine children.
Phyllis graduated from St. Rose Philippine Duchesne High School. In 1953, she married the love of her life, Edward Berry. Together they had five children, John, Thomas, Lisa, Lora and Susan.
Phyllis worked as a domestic engineer, taking loving care of her family and home. She was an avid reader, quilter and she enjoyed cooking and baking, bird watching, traveling, sewing, bingo, playing cards, attending daily mass, and she was an excellent gift giver. She was also a Nebraska Cornhusker football fan.
Phyllis was preceded in death by her parents; husband, Ed; siblings, Sister Maura, Tom, Dan, Chuck, Paul, John, Theresa; son, John and great grandchild, Viviana. She is survived by her sister, Carol Jeffs; children, Dr. Thomas (Janet) Berry, Lisa Berry, Lora (William) Kopper and Susan (Theodore) Sponsel; 15 grandchildren and 24 great grandchildren.
